How to Prepare Ofe Ugba (Shredded Oil Bean Soup) With This Simple Recipe

Ofe Ugba, also known as Shredded Oil Soup, is a soup native to eastern Nigeria, especially the people of Owerri and Mbaise in Imo State.

It can also be called “Ofe Ukpaka,” because the seed of African beans is called Ugba or Ukpaka, depending on where the Igbo comes from.

Its main ingredient is Ugba, which gives this soup a delicious taste and aroma.

Ingredients

For four meals, you will need:

  • 20 okra fingers
  • Cow meat
  • 1 cup of ugba (a cup of milk is okay)
  • 2 pieces of dried fish (dried catfish)
  • 2 pieces of cod
  • 1 smoked mackerel (smoked titus fish)
  • 2 tablespoons of palm oil
  • Habanero pepper (atarodo)
  • 1 handful of crabs
  • 1 piece of okpei ogiri (Dawa Dawa, iru)
  • 1 onion
  • Cowskin (Ponmo)
  • Pumpkin leaves (Ugu)
  • Salt to taste)
  • Condiments
